The Power of Enough

As in enough noise, enough talking, enough stuff, enough arguing, enough hurting, enough criticism.

You don’t need the best one. You don’t need to be the best parent. You don’t need the most likes or followers.

What you have, and who you are are good enough.

In a world that’s constantly shouting at you to get more, do more and be better, it’s a necessary reminder. Put it as an alarm on your phone or on a post-it. The people who want you to believe you’re not enough want something from you and you don’t need to give them your power.

Remember you don’t need external things to be enough. You already are. For additional support, check out our top posts this week on what you really need to be happy, what love is not and what you need to do to stop choosing the wrong partner.
